This repository has been archived by the owner on Aug 4, 2020. It is now read-only.
-
Notifications
You must be signed in to change notification settings - Fork 3
/
Copy pathrequirements.html
95 lines (83 loc) · 3.87 KB
/
requirements.html
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
<!DOCTYPE html>
<html>
<head>
<title>ArchivesSpace API Workshop</title>
<link href="/css/site.css" rel="stylesheet" />
</head>
<body>
<header><p><img src="https://www.gravatar.com/avatar/60c7b20527f236c7156a85772a97430f.png" title="When I press keys letters and punctuation sometimes appear on the surface." alt="Androidified Robert in a beret and black t-shirt."><div>Robert Doiel<br />Digital Services Programmer<br /><a href="http://library.caltech.edu">Caltech Libraries</a><br /></div></p>
</header>
<section><h1>Requirements</h1>
<ul>
<li>A laptop/device with network access
<ul>
<li>Linux (what I use), Mac OS X (which I am familiar with), or Windows (which I am very very rusty on)</li>
<li>Python 3 installed including the python standard library (see <a href="https://docs.python.org/3/library/">https://docs.python.org/3/library/</a>)
<ul>
<li>Python 3 (v3.5.2) can be downloaded and from <a href="https://www.python.org/downloads/">https://www.python.org/downloads/</a></li>
<li>We’ll be making heavy use of urllib and json modules</li>
</ul></li>
</ul></li>
<li>A text Editor</li>
<li>A web browser</li>
<li>Access to ArchivesSpace REST API
<ul>
<li>The workshop hosts will provide access for Aug 2nd</li>
<li>If you have <a href="https://www.virtualbox.org/">Virtualbox</a> and <a href="https://www.vagrantup.com/">Vagrant</a> installed
I have provided <a href="https://github.com/rsdoiel/archivesspace-api-workshop/archivesspace-dev">archivesspace-dev</a></li>
</ul></li>
<li>A basic familiarity with Python</li>
</ul>
<h2>Before the workshop</h2>
<ul>
<li>Make sure you have a modern web browser
<ul>
<li>Firefox or Chrome with the <a href="https://jsonview.com/">JSONView</a> plugin recommented</li>
</ul></li>
<li>Make sure you have <a href="https://www.python.org/downloads/">Python 3.5.2</a>
<ul>
<li>Install <a href="https://www.python.org/downloads/">Python 3.5.2</a> if needed</li>
</ul></li>
<li>Make sure you have a text editor
<ul>
<li>IDLE for Python 3 is what I will use in the Workshop</li>
</ul></li>
<li>A test deployment ArchivesSpace is being provided as part of the Workshop
<ul>
<li>You can install your own via <a href="http://github.com/rsdoiel/archivesspace-api-workshop/archivesspace-dev/">VirtualBox and Vagrant</a></li>
</ul></li>
<li>Recommended reading
<ul>
<li>Read through the <a href="https://docs.python.org/3/tutorial/index.html">Python 3 tutorial</a> if they are not familiar with Python.</li>
</ul></li>
<li>Bookmark in your web browser:
<ul>
<li><a href="http://archivesspace.github.io/archivesspace/api/">ArchivesSpace API Docs</a></li>
<li><a href="https://docs.python.org/3/library/index.html">Python Reference</a></li>
<li><a href="https://rsdoiel.github.io/archivesspace-api-workshop">This presentation website</a></li>
</ul></li>
</ul>
</section>
<nav><ul>
<li><a href="/">Home</a></li>
<li><a href="./index.html">About Presentation</a></li>
<li><a href="abstract.html">Abstract</a></li>
<li><a href="requirements.html">Before the workshop …</a></li>
<li><a href="00-ArchivesSpace-API-Workshop.html">View Presentation</a></li>
<li><a href="https://www.python.org/downloads/">How to install Python 3</a></li>
<li><a href="archivesspace-dev/index.html">How to install ArchivesSpace</a></li>
<li><a href="./install.html">How to install the presentation</a></li>
<li><a href="https://github.com/rsdoiel/archivesspace-api-workshop">Github repo</a></li>
</ul>
</nav>
<footer><p>copyright © 2016, released under the <a href="LICENSE">3-Clause BSD License</a><br />
built with
<a href="https://github.com/rsdoiel/shorthand">shorthand</a>,
<a href="https://github.com/rsdoiel/reldate">reldate</a>,
<a href="https://github.com/rsdoiel/pathparts">pathparts</a>,
<a href="https://github.com/rsdoiel/findfile">findfile</a>,
<a href="https://github.com/rsdoiel/timefmt">timefmt</a>,
Make and Bash<br /></p>
</footer>
</body>
</html>